All good things must come to an end, and in another weird moment from an overall weird game, wide receiver Mohamed Sanu’s run of passing completions has been snapped. Sanu entered today’s game six-for-six with a perfect 158.3 rating as a passer, but he now has one incompletion as the lone blemish on his career at quarterback.
